Black Wolves lacrosse leadership returns

It was announced that the New England Black Wolves coaching and management staff will return to the organization. General Manager and Head Coach Glenn Clark, Assistant General Manager and Defensive Coordinator Clem D’Orazio and Offensive Coordinator Darryl Gibson have agreed to multi-year extensions. Black Wolves Acquire Tanner Thomson

The New England Black Wolves announced today that the team has acquired Tanner Thomson from the Saskatchewan Rush in exchange for Tristan Rai and a second round selection in the 2023 Entry Draft. New England Black Wolves name Clark General Manager, D’Orazio adds Assistant General Manager tag

The New England Black Wolves announced today that General Manager Rich Lisk will depart the organization on Jan. 31, 2020. Head Coach Glenn Clark will take on a dual role, adding General Manager duties and Assistant Coach Clem D’Orzaio will also become Assistant General Manager.
